Job Responsibilities

  • Leads and manages tasks associated with the preparation and modification of various project-level engineering documents including reports, specifications, plans, cost estimates and designs for projects;
  • Prepares the planning, design and permitting documents of civil engineering, land development and infrastructure projects in close collaboration with Project Personnel using engineering and design software (AutoCAD, Civil 3D, etc.) and equipment;
  • Applies knowledge and techniques of engineering and advanced mathematics;
  • Coordinates the work of staff engineers, interns and others who assist in specific assignments, as needed;
  • Writes and/or reviews draft reports, including feasibility studies, stormwater management reports, technical specifications, and utility reports;
  • Performs cost calculations and determines feasibility of projects based on the analysis of collected data. Reviews all work product prepared by staff;
  • Reviews draft invoices and project budgets with Project Personnel;
  • Collaborates with Project Personnel in coaching and training staff. Prepares draft proposals in collaboration with Project Personnel;
  • Effectively uses software, reports, maps, drawings, engineering plans, tests, aerial photographs, and guidelines and manuals to assess soil composition, terrain, hydraulic and hydrological characteristics, and topographical and geologic data to plan and design projects. Applies knowledge of sustainability and resiliency best practices to projects; and
  • Performs zoning, sustainability and other feasibility assessments for development projects. Coordinates and performs field inspection services, as needed.

Qualifications

  • This position requires a Bachelor's Degree or foreign equivalent in Civil Engineering or a closely related field of study plus three (3) years of experience in the job offered or a related occupation.
  • In addition, must have 3 years of experience in each of the following:
    • Site and civil design for construction projects;
    • Site planning, land grading, storm water management, drainage and soil erosion;
    • AutoCAD;
    • Preparing and modifying engineering documents including reports, specification, plans, construction schedules, cost estimates and design plans for projects using engineering and design software;
    • Using reports, maps, drawings, engineering plans, tests and aerial photographs to assess soil composition, terrain, hydrological characteristics, and topographical and geologic data and their impact on the design of projects;
    • Federal land use permitting; and,
    • Experience with state and local land use permitting in New Jersey.
  • Travel Requirement: This position requires up to 10% domestic travel.
